Flagging this before the sync: the Brambleweed cleanup bot now deletes branches it considers stale, but the thresholds are hardcoded in three places, and they disagree. In one path a branch is stale after inactivity alone; in another it also requires a merged PR. Please consolidate into a single config module so we can reason about one source of truth, and document why each default was chosen. For discussion, here are the values currently in effect.

tuning constants:
QUOTAS = {
    "druwyn": 2,
    "ulaix": 5,
    "zorath": 10,
    "quenix": 5,
}

## Step 2: Update ParityScope's scan settings

Quick one for review: this step migrates our hotel rate-parity checker off the old Dunmore polling scheme. ParityScope now compares rates per channel in batches instead of one giant nightly sweep, so the old interval settings are meaningless. I've ripped those out. Please sanity-check that the new batching and tolerance knobs look reasonable — the migrated service should start with these configuration values:

settings of tagef-bawif:
DRUIX_HOST=druix.zemvarlabs.internal
DRUIX_PORT=8000

Ticket #— Floor 9 Opening Prep, Brindlemoor House

Hi facilities folks, Floor 9 opens to staff next Monday and we need a few things squared away before then. Lift access is live, but the two side doors by the kitchenette are still on the old lock config — please reprogram them before Friday. Also, signage for the quiet rooms hasn't arrived, so pop up the temporary printed ones for now. Until the badge readers sync, the interim door code for Floor 9 is below.

door code, bajop-bajog: bdg-DSWAC-43621

# Dedupe-o-tron Environments

Dedupe-o-tron collapses duplicate on-call alerts before they hit the pager. We run three environments: sandbox, staging, and prod, each with its own suppression window and fingerprint rules. Staging mirrors prod traffic at 10%, so don't panic about low volumes there. The current per-environment configuration is listed below.

settings of fafog-haduf:
ZORIX_PIN=4648
ZORIX_METRICS_HOST=metrics.zorix.paliqsys.corp
ZORIX_LOG_LEVEL=info
ZORIX_TENANT=druix